George Stephen Bondor, Sr., age 95, passed away on November 9, 2012 just shy of his 96th birthday. George was born in Youngstown, Ohio on November 17, 1916 to Istvan and Magdolna Bondor. He fought WW II in the South Pacific as an Army Field Artillery officer and was part of the force that liberated the Philippines. After the war he settled in Dayton, Ohio where he and his new wife raised four boys. He worked for the Government at Wright-Patterson AFB as a professional licensed mechanical engineer. He enjoyed family activities and these included extended family camping trips through the Canadian Rockies as well as trips to and hikes down into the Grand Canyon. He loved organizing these expeditions. He was very active in his church both in Dayton and in Bellevue at St Margaret's Episcopal Church. George is preceded in death by his wife, Margaret Lydia Francis Gagyi Bondor. He is survived by his 4 sons, George (Carol) Bondor, Jr., David (Mary) Bondor, Kenneth (Sally) Bondor and Michael (Maureen) Bondor as well as 6 grandchildren and 3 great grandchildren.
